Principle Software Engineer

1 month ago


Philadelphia, United States Robert Half Full time

About the Company

Our client, located in Philadelphia, is looking to hire a Senior (staff level) Software Engineer to join their talented engineering team as a full time team member. This is an excellent opportunity to join a growing product technology company, in a key role, within a stable and growing industry. The role will be hybrid/remote, with 2 days on-site at their office in Philadelphia.


About the Role

  • Design and build APIs that support the data platform and pipelines
  • Work collaboratively with a team of driven engineers, engaging in paired programming and code reviews
  • Work with key stakeholders to refine requirements and eliminate ambiguity
  • Work with our product teams to understand the needs of our users and build the software that addresses those needs
  • Improve the software development process through agile ceremonies
  • Mentor engineers and foster an environment of collaboration and learning


Responsibilities

  • 8+ years of software development experience
  • 5+ years of Python experience
  • 3+ years of AWS experience
  • 4+ years experience with javascript or modern frameworks (React js preferred)
  • Experience with continuous integration and continuous deployment technologies
  • 3+ years of experience building data pipelines
  • Experience with serverless framework

Qualifications

  • Bachelor’s in computer science, engineering or related field
  • Prior experience developing software in a fast paced, start up environment
  • Experience working in regulated industry like healthcare or finance with compliance requirements
  • Experience in application architecture, microservice architecture, event driven architectures, messaging systems, and domain driven design
  • Experience with Airflow
  • Experience working with Lean / Agile development methodologies
  • 3+ years of Spark, or similar technologies, experience



  • Philadelphia, United States Robert Half Full time

    About the CompanyOur client, located in Philadelphia, is looking to hire a Senior (staff level) Software Engineer to join their talented engineering team as a full time team member. This is an excellent opportunity to join a growing product technology company, in a key role, within a stable and growing industry. The role will be hybrid/remote, with 2 days...


  • Philadelphia, Pennsylvania, United States Liberty Personnel Services, Inc. Full time

    Position Overview:Liberty Personnel Services, Inc. is seeking a dedicated and experienced Software Engineering Manager. This role involves overseeing a dynamic engineering team while ensuring alignment with overarching business goals.Key Responsibilities:Provide strategic technical direction and leadership to the engineering team.Oversee the architecture,...


  • Philadelphia, Pennsylvania, United States Liberty Personnel Services, Inc. Full time

    Position Overview:Liberty Personnel Services, Inc. is seeking a dedicated and experienced Software Engineering Manager. This role is pivotal in guiding a dynamic engineering team and driving the development of innovative software solutions.Key Responsibilities:Provide strategic technical leadership, ensuring alignment between engineering initiatives and...


  • Philadelphia, Pennsylvania, United States Liberty Personnel Services, Inc. Full time

    Position Overview:Liberty Personnel Services, Inc. is seeking a dedicated and experienced Software Engineering Manager. This role requires a hands-on leader who will guide a dynamic engineering team within a thriving organization.Key Responsibilities:Provide strategic technical direction, ensuring the engineering team meets business goals.Oversee the...


  • Philadelphia, Pennsylvania, United States Liberty Personnel Services, Inc. Full time

    Position Overview:Liberty Personnel Services, Inc. is seeking a dynamic and experienced Software Engineering Manager to oversee our innovative engineering team. This full-time role emphasizes hands-on leadership within a progressive organization.Key Responsibilities:Provide strategic technical direction, ensuring alignment between engineering initiatives and...


  • Philadelphia, Pennsylvania, United States Liberty Personnel Services, Inc. Full time

    Position Overview:Liberty Personnel Services, Inc. is seeking a dedicated and experienced Software Engineering Manager. This pivotal role involves overseeing a dynamic engineering team and driving the development of innovative software solutions. The position operates on a hybrid work model, allowing for flexibility while ensuring productivity.Key...

  • Software Engineer

    22 hours ago


    Philadelphia, Pennsylvania, United States Liberty Personnel Services, Inc Full time

    Job OverviewLiberty Personnel Services, Inc. is seeking highly skilled Software Engineers to join our team. As a leading technical recruiting agency, we have multiple full-time openings for Mid-Senior Software Developers.The ideal candidate will have experience with a range of technologies, including:.Net CoreC#Service-oriented ArchitectureAPIs as a data...


  • Philadelphia, Pennsylvania, United States Jobot Full time

    About Jobot: We are a leading global provider of software solutions, specializing in data analysis, aggregation, and visualization services tailored for core infrastructure and energy sectors.Your Role: As a valued member of our team, you will engage with seasoned professionals across various expertise levels, promoting a culture of collaboration and...


  • Philadelphia, Pennsylvania, United States Liberty Personnel Services, Inc. Full time

    Position Overview:Liberty Personnel Services, Inc. is seeking a dedicated and experienced Software Engineering Manager. This pivotal role involves overseeing a dynamic engineering team and driving the development of innovative software solutions.Key Responsibilities:Provide strategic technical leadership, ensuring alignment between engineering initiatives...


  • Philadelphia, Pennsylvania, United States Jobot Full time

    About Jobot: We are a leading global SaaS provider dedicated to enhancing the operational efficiency of core infrastructure and energy sectors through advanced data analysis, aggregation, and visualization solutions.Your Role: As a valued member of our team, you will collaborate with seasoned technology professionals across various disciplines, promoting a...


  • Philadelphia, Pennsylvania, United States Jobot Full time

    About Jobot: We are a leading global SaaS provider specializing in delivering data analysis, aggregation, and visualization solutions tailored for core infrastructure and energy sectors.Your Role: As a vital member of our team, you will engage with seasoned professionals across various expertise levels, promoting a culture of collaboration and mentorship....


  • Philadelphia, Pennsylvania, United States OSIsoft Full time

    Role Overview: As a Senior Software Engineer, you will play a pivotal role in shaping the technical direction of our projects at OSIsoft. Your expertise will be essential in making informed technical decisions that affect various dimensions such as scalability, reliability, and performance. Key Responsibilities: Design, develop, test, and troubleshoot...

  • Software Engineer

    2 weeks ago


    Philadelphia, Pennsylvania, United States Mondo Full time

    Job OverviewWe are seeking a skilled Java Developer for a hybrid role. This position is focused on delivering high-quality software solutions and is ideal for candidates with a strong technical background.Position DetailsJob Title: Java DeveloperLocation: HybridType: Long-term ContractCompensation: $53-$64 per hour W2Role SummaryThe primary responsibility of...


  • Philadelphia, Pennsylvania, United States Vistar Media Full time

    About the RoleWe are seeking a seasoned Software Engineering Team Lead to oversee the development and maintenance of our cloud-based infrastructure. As a key member of our engineering team, you will be responsible for managing a team of software engineers focused on building and maintaining our cloud infrastructure using Infrastructure as Code (IaC)...

  • Software Engineer III

    4 weeks ago


    Philadelphia, United States RevZilla Full time

    Job DescriptionJob DescriptionCompany DescriptionComoto Holdings is America’s largest and fastest-growing omnichannel platform in the powersports aftermarket-products industry; dedicated to advancing the experience of powersports enthusiasts across the globe. Comoto’s brands, RevZilla, Cycle Gear, J&P Cycles, REVER, and Common Tread,  deliver premium...

  • Software Engineer III

    4 weeks ago


    Philadelphia, United States RevZilla Full time

    Job DescriptionJob DescriptionCompany DescriptionComoto Holdings is America’s largest and fastest-growing omnichannel platform in the powersports aftermarket-products industry; dedicated to advancing the experience of powersports enthusiasts across the globe. Comoto’s brands, RevZilla, Cycle Gear, J&P Cycles, REVER, and Common Tread,  deliver premium...


  • Philadelphia, Pennsylvania, United States NeuroFlow Full time

    Job OverviewAbout UsAt NeuroFlow, we are dedicated to transforming the behavioral health landscape. Founded by Christopher Molaro, a West Point graduate and former army officer, our mission is rooted in addressing the significant barriers that individuals face in accessing timely and effective mental health care.Alongside co-founder Adam Pardes, Chris...

  • Software Engineer

    12 hours ago


    Philadelphia, Pennsylvania, United States EHS TECHNOLOGIES CORPORATION Full time

    Job OverviewEHS Technologies Corporation is seeking a highly skilled Software Engineer to join our team. As a key member of our engineering department, you will be responsible for designing, developing, and implementing software solutions to meet the company's technical needs.Key ResponsibilitiesDesign and develop software applications using various...


  • Philadelphia, United States American Bible Society Full time

    Job DescriptionJob DescriptionDIGITAL BIBLE LAB PURPOSEThe Software Engineer will join the Digital Bible Lab team at American Bible Society. We work with a vast network of global partners to remove barriers to Scripture access through developing and supporting amazing software products. The work of the team is heavily focused on the Habakkuk 2:14 vision that...


  • Philadelphia, United States Comoto Full time

    Job DescriptionJob DescriptionCompany DescriptionComoto Holdings is America’s largest and fastest-growing omnichannel platform in the powersports aftermarket-products industry; dedicated to advancing the experience of powersports enthusiasts across the globe. Comoto’s brands, RevZilla, Cycle Gear, J&P Cycles, REVER, and Common Tread,  deliver premium...